Best time to go to Strumpshaw Steam Museum

The best time to visit Strumpshaw Steam Museum can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ature around Strumpshaw Steam Museum fal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ature around Strumpshaw Steam Museum falls in January,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with no rain (dry).

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January40.3°F (4.6°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
February41.2°F (5.1°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.7°F (6.5°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April47.3°F (8.5°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ly SunnyAverageAverage
May52.7°F (11.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June58.3°F (14.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
July62.6°F (17.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
August63.3°F (17.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
September59.5°F (15.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October54.1°F (12.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
November47.5°F (8.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December42.8°F (6.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
